    A Tribute to FDNY’s Daniel Suhr: A Hero’s Legacy from 9/11

    Daniel Suhr, a firefighter with the FDNY, is remembered for his bravery, dedication, and the love he shared with his family. He tragically lost his life on September 11, 2001, while rushing to the World Trade Center, leaving behind a legacy of heroism that continues to inspire.

    What Happened

    On September 11, 2001, Daniel Suhr, a firefighter with Engine Company 216, was one of the many first responders who rushed to the World Trade Center after the terrorist attacks. As he and his fellow firefighters ran toward the disaster, an unimaginable event occurred—someone fell from the sky and landed on top of him. Despite the immense danger and uncertainty, Daniel’s fellow firefighters remained by his side, unwilling to leave him behind. This act of bravery, as his wife Nancy put it, “saved their lives.” Daniel’s selflessness during those final moments is a testament to his courage and commitment to others.

    Who Is Daniel Suhr

    Daniel Suhr, 37, was a beloved firefighter and a hero who made sure those around him were always safe. Known as “Captain America,” he was a larger-than-life figure who was always looking out for others. Growing up in Brooklyn, he was the captain of both the baseball and football teams at James Madison High School. He followed in his father’s footsteps and became a firefighter, with his brother also in the same profession. In his personal life, Daniel was deeply devoted to his wife, Nancy, and their young daughter, Briana. Despite his reputation as a tough firefighter, he had a soft side, especially when it came to his daughter. He loved her “more than life itself,” Nancy recalls, and was terrified whenever she ran toward him too fast.
